Fitzwilliam to Spalding by train

A train trip from Fitzwilliam to Spalding takes about 2hrs 49 mins on average, covering roughly 77 miles (124 kilometres). With around 19 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£13.20,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

What are my cheap ticket options for Fitzwilliam to Spalding journ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Fitzwilliam to Spalding start from as little as £13.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Fitzwilliam to Spalding start from £45.10 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Fitzwilliam to Spalding are available for £80.60 one way

Station Amenities and Facilities

Fitzwilliam Station is devoid of a ticket office, which some travelers might find uncommon. However, worry not as there are ticket machines available to purchase and collect pre-booked online tickets. These machines are accessible, making it convenient for all passengers. Unfortunately, there are no waiting room facilities or refreshment options, and the station is unstaffed, limiting in-person assistance. On the bright side, there's CCTV for security, step-free access to platforms, and a few accessible car parking spaces available with 103 spaces overall. Smartcards can be issued here but keep in mind there are no smartcard validators on-site.

Getting to and From the Station

If you are planning your visit to Fitzwilliam Station, you will find various transport links available. Rail replacement services pick up and drop off on Wakefield Road, ensuring continuity in cases of rail service disruptions. Although there isn't a designated taxi rank, you can pre-book taxis via this link. For those preferring bus services, the closest stop is a brief five-minute walk, but be aware it isn’t signposted, so a quick inquiry might be essential. Cyclists will find some bike storage facilities—although these are not covered, so bring your bike locks!

Facilities and Amenities at Spalding Train Station

Spalding train station is equipped to meet the needs of every traveller.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with both a ticket office and machines available, ensuring you can seamlessly collect tickets bought online. While there are no smartcards issued at the station, you will find validators for your convenience.

Accessibility is a top priority here, with step-free access spanning the entirety of the station. Lifts and tactile paving ensure ease of movement, while accessible ticket machines and induction loops cater to various needs. Despite the absence of waiting lounges or refreshments, basic facilities like toilets (including accessible ones) are well-maintained.

Travelers will appreciate the well-managed car park operated by East Midlands Railway, with ample parking spaces, including three designated for accessible use, and an option to pay via RingGO.

Getting to and from Spalding Station

Spalding station offers simple onward travel options. For connections beyond the rail network, you’ll find a convenient taxi rank and a bus stop for any rail replacement services right outside the station. With several local taxi services like 1st Choice and Mels on call, getting to and around Spalding is a breeze.
